You'll save a bundle on cleaning your car if you use your own elbow grease and homemade cleaners.

There's nothing more fun for the kiddos than putting on their bathing suits and heading out to the driveway with a bucket of warm soapy water and a sponge. Adults can take care of the grime around chrome and windshields using a wet sponge and baking soda.

Don't forget to wipe down those windows inside and out with vinegar. Just apply to a wet rag and wipe.
For the interior of your car, use a vinegar and water mixture to lift odors out of seats and floors.

For stains, mix laundry detergent with water and hand scrub. Blot out moisture with a dry cloth. You'll have that new car smell and shine in no time with a little time, effort and frugal thinking!
